. Here is the paragraph: When it comes to cooking frozen chicken wings in an air fryer, one of the most important things to keep in mind is the temperature and cooking time. The ideal temperature for cooking frozen chicken wings in an air fryer is between 400°F (200°C) and 420°F (220°C). This high heat will help to crisp up the exterior of the wings while cooking the interior to a safe internal temperature. As for the cooking time, it will depend on the size and thickness of the wings. Generally, you can cook frozen chicken wings in an air fryer for 20-25 minutes, shaking the basket halfway through. However, if you prefer your wings extra crispy, you can increase the cooking time to 30-35 minutes. It's also important to note that you should not overcrowd the air fryer basket, as this can prevent the wings from cooking evenly. Instead, cook the wings in batches if necessary, to ensure that they have enough room to cook properly. By following these temperature and cooking time guidelines, you can achieve perfectly cooked frozen chicken wings in your air fryer that are crispy on the outside and juicy on the inside.
